| Client: | Emirates Telecommunications Corporation Ltd (Etisalat) |
| Consultant: | Swedish Telecoms International AB |
| Location: | Port Zayed, Abu Dhabi |
| Started: | July, 1989 |
| Completed: | May, 1990 |
| Value: | Dhs 4,594,484 |
The depot is a building 50.2 metres long by 37.5 metres wide by 13.9 metres high, composed of three floors.
The ground floor holds eight 10m diameter reinforced concrete cable storage tanks, stores, workshop, offices and services.
The upper floor contains a work area with two cable hauling machines and two 1 ton capacity monorails. The intermediate floor is for air conditioning equipment and a water tank.
The roof is a pre-engineered steel structure with insulated double cladding. The construction is reinforced concrete resting on piles. Walls on three sides are single skin steel cladding while the fourth is plastered and painted block work.
The works also included the design for civil, architectural, electrical, plumbing, HVAC, shop drawings and securing all necessary municipal permits.
